轻松掌握Excel宏录制技巧:自动将数据转移到另一张表的步骤解析

admin

如何使用Excel宏录制功能自动转移数据

近年来,越来越多的人希望提高工作效率,尤其是在使用Excel时,宏录制功能成为了一个非常实用的工具。本文将为大家详细介绍如何通过宏录制功能,将输入的内容自动转移到其他表格,希望能够帮助有这方面需求的朋友们。

步骤一:制作来访登记总表的表头

首先,我们需要创建一个来访登记总表的表头,确保包含必要的列,如“编号”、“姓名”、“来访时间”等字段,以便后续的记录和管理。

步骤二:制作来访登记表

接着,您需要制作一个来访登记表,用于记录访客的信息。表格应简洁明了,便于填写。

轻松掌握Excel宏录制技巧:自动将数据转移到另一张表的步骤解析

步骤三:设计数据有效性

为了提高数据的准确性,您可以根据实际需求设计数据有效性选项。如限制输入特定的文字或设定数值的长度等,确保数据的完整性和正确性。

步骤四:管理名称

通过“公式-名称管理器”,您可以管理和编辑表的名称,这样在进行跨表引用时会更加方便。将编辑的表名称设置为“来访登记信息总表”

步骤五:实现自动编号

在来访登记表中,输入公式:=COUNT(来访登记信息总表[编号])+1。这样可以实现自动编号,简化操作流程。

步骤六:使用IF函数判断信息完整性

为了确保填写的信息完整性,您可以使用以下IF函数:=IF(AND(C5<>"",E5<>"",C6<>"",C7<>"",E7<>"",C8<>"",C9<>""),"信息填写完整","信息填写不完整")。其中,<>表示单元格有数据,""表示单元格为空白。

步骤七:录制宏

在“开发工具”中选择“录制宏”,给宏起一个合适的名称。确保开始录制前准备好相应的操作步骤。

步骤八:插入和复制数据

在总表中插入一行后,回到登记表,选择复制数据。请务必选择“开始”菜单中的“复制”和“粘贴”(选择粘贴为数值),不要使用快捷键进行操作。输入完毕后,停止录制。

步骤九:链接宏与表单控件按钮

完成后,您可以插入表单控件按钮,并将其链接至刚刚创建的宏。这样,您便能够一键执行数据转移的操作。

步骤十:编写宏判断信息完整性

接下来,使用IF函数编辑宏,确保只有在表格信息完整时才执行自动录入。在“开发工具”中打开“Visual Basic”,进行宏代码的编辑。

步骤十一:编写条件语句

在宏开头添加以下语句:If Range("B10").Text = "信息填写完整" Then,确保在信息填写完整时,才能执行数据转移。

步骤十二:设置数据不完整提示

在宏结尾添加:Else MsgBox "数据不完整不能输入到总表" End If。这样一来,当信息填写不完整时,点击自动录入按钮后,系统会弹出提示窗口。

如果您还对如何使用Excel的宏录制功能实现自动转移输入内容到另一张表的操作流程感到困惑,不妨参考以上步骤,操作起来会更加得心应手。